Victoria Falls

Victoria Falls is a waterfall in southern Africa. It is located on the Zambezi River at the border of Zambia and Zimbabwe. It has a width of 1,708m (5,604 ft) and a height of 108m (354 ft) which forms the largest sheet of falling water in the world. Victoria Falls is a UNESCO World Heritage site.

1,113 Questions

No questions found for given filters. Try a different search or filter.